重力感应H5上海方案分享

重力感应H5上海方案分享,手机倾斜交互,重力感应H5,设备运动感应 2025-11-04 内容来源 重力感应H5

在当今数字化时代,企业越来越注重用户体验的提升,特别是在上海这样的国际化大都市。重力感应H5应用作为一种新兴的技术手段,正在逐渐改变品牌与用户之间的互动方式。本文将深入探讨这一技术在上海的应用场景,从其背景价值出发,详细介绍实现方案,并针对实际操作中的常见问题提供优化建议。

重力感应H5的背景价值

随着移动互联网的普及,用户对互动体验的要求越来越高。传统的网页和应用已经无法满足用户的多样化需求,而重力感应H5则通过利用手机内置的加速度传感器和陀螺仪,为用户提供更加沉浸式的交互体验。对于上海的企业而言,这种技术不仅能增强品牌形象,还能有效提高用户的参与度和忠诚度。

例如,在一些线上活动中,用户可以通过倾斜或摇晃手机来触发特定的动画效果或解锁隐藏内容,这种新颖的互动方式不仅能够吸引用户的注意力,还能增加品牌的曝光率。此外,重力感应H5还可以应用于游戏、广告、教育等多个领域,为企业带来更多的商业机会。

重力感应H5

当前主流的实现方案与常见做法

要实现一个成功的重力感应H5项目,开发者需要选择合适的开发工具和技术栈。目前市面上常用的开发工具包括HTML5、CSS3和JavaScript,其中JavaScript是实现重力感应功能的核心语言。通过监听设备的devicemotion事件,开发者可以获取到设备的加速度信息,并根据这些数据进行相应的处理。

开发工具的选择

  • HTML5:作为新一代的网页标准,HTML5提供了丰富的API接口,支持多种传感器的调用,非常适合用于开发重力感应H5应用。
  • CSS3:主要用于页面的布局和样式设计,确保应用在不同设备上都能有良好的视觉效果。
  • JavaScript:负责处理逻辑和动态交互,是实现重力感应功能的关键。

适配策略

由于不同设备的操作系统和浏览器内核存在差异,适配性是一个不容忽视的问题。为了确保应用在各种设备上都能正常运行,开发者需要进行广泛的兼容性测试,并采用渐进增强和优雅降级的设计理念。具体来说,可以通过以下几种方式进行适配:

  • 响应式设计:使用媒体查询(Media Query)调整页面布局,以适应不同的屏幕尺寸。
  • Polyfill:为不支持某些API的旧版浏览器提供替代方案,确保应用的基本功能不受影响。
  • 性能优化:减少不必要的资源加载,优化代码结构,提升应用的加载速度和流畅度。

兼容性与性能问题及优化建议

尽管重力感应H5具有诸多优势,但在实际开发过程中,开发者往往会遇到一些兼容性和性能方面的问题。这些问题如果处理不当,可能会导致应用在某些设备上出现卡顿、延迟甚至崩溃的情况。

常见的兼容性问题

  1. 浏览器兼容性:不同浏览器对重力感应API的支持程度不一,尤其是在iOS和Android平台之间存在较大差异。开发者需要针对不同浏览器进行针对性优化,确保应用在各个平台上都能稳定运行。
  2. 设备差异:即使是同一款浏览器,在不同型号的手机上也可能表现出不同的行为。因此,在开发过程中应尽量考虑到设备硬件的多样性,进行充分的测试。

性能优化建议

  1. 减少资源加载:避免一次性加载过多的图片、音频等资源,可以采用懒加载(Lazy Load)技术,按需加载资源,减轻服务器压力。
  2. 优化代码结构:精简代码,去除冗余部分,提升执行效率。同时,合理使用缓存机制,减少重复计算。
  3. 异步加载:将非关键资源异步加载,优先保证核心功能的流畅运行。

结语

综上所述,重力感应H5作为一种创新的互动方式,为上海地区的品牌和开发者提供了全新的思路和机遇。通过合理的开发工具选择和适配策略,以及有效的性能优化措施,可以打造出既具创意又实用的互动应用。如果你正在寻找专业的团队帮助你实现这一目标,我们拥有丰富的经验和成功案例,致力于为您提供一站式的解决方案。欢迎随时联系我们,联系电话17723342546,微信同号。

— THE END —

服务介绍

专注于互动营销技术开发

重力感应H5上海方案分享,手机倾斜交互,重力感应H5,设备运动感应 联系电话:17723342546(微信同号)